MINOR: dns: add DNS statistics
add a new command on the stats socket to print a DNS resolvers section
(including per server) statistics: "show stats resolvers <id>"

+show stat resolvers <resolvers section id>
+ Dump statistics for the given resolvers section.
+ For each name server, the following counters are reported:
+ sent: number of DNS requests sent to this server
+ valid: number of DNS valid responses received from this server
+ update: number of DNS responses used to update the server's IP address
+ cname: number of CNAME responses
+ cname_error: CNAME errors encountered with this server
+ any_err: number of empty response (IE: server does not support ANY type)
+ nx: non existent domain response received from this server
+ timeout: how many time this server did not answer in time
+ refused: number of requests refused by this server
+ other: any other DNS errors
+ invalid: invalid DNS response (from a protocol point of view)
+ too_big: too big response
+ outdated: number of response arrived too late (after an other name server)
